Kyle Chen
c52c49785d
Add linear learning rate scheduler ( #1443 )
2024-03-12 13:04:12 -04:00
Dilshod Tadjibaev
0138e16af6
Add Enum module support in PyTorchFileRecorder ( #1436 )
...
* Add Enum module support in PyTorchFileRecorder
Fixes #1431
* Fix wording/typos per PR feedback
2024-03-11 11:21:01 -05:00
Dilshod Tadjibaev
c7d4c23f97
Support for non-contiguous indexes in PyTorchFileRecorder keys ( #1432 )
...
* Fix non-contiguous indexes
* Update pytorch-model.md
* Simplify multiple forwards
2024-03-07 13:40:57 -06:00
Dilshod Tadjibaev
b12646de0a
Truncate debug display for NestedValue ( #1428 )
...
* Truncate debug display for NestedValue
* Fix failing tests
2024-03-07 08:06:31 -05:00
Dilshod Tadjibaev
545444c02a
PyTorchFileRecord print debug option ( #1425 )
...
* Add debug print option to PyTorchFileRecorder
* Updated documentation and improved print output
* Improve print wording
* Updated per PR feedback
2024-03-06 16:11:37 -06:00
Dilshod Tadjibaev
d43a0b3f90
Add is_close and all_close tensor operators ( #1389 )
...
* Add is_close and all_close tensor operators
* Fix broken build issues
* Fix the table
* Add tests to candle
2024-03-01 15:37:14 -06:00
Dilshod Tadjibaev
688958ee74
Enhance PyTorchRecorder to pass top-level key to extract state_dict ( #1300 )
...
* Enhance PyTorchRecorder to pass top level key to extract state_dict
This is needed for Whisper weight pt files.
* Fix missing hyphens
* Move top-level-key test under crates
* Add sub-crates as members of workspace
* Update Cargo.lock
* Add accidentally omitted line during merge
2024-02-29 12:57:27 -06:00
Yu Sun
330552afb4
docs(book-&-examples): modify book and examples with new `prelude` module ( #1372 )
2024-02-28 13:25:25 -05:00
Arjun31415
8e23057c6b
Feature Addition: PRelu Module ( #1328 )
2024-02-24 10:24:22 -05:00
Yu Sun
1da47c9bf1
feat: add prelude module for convenience ( #1335 )
2024-02-24 10:17:30 -05:00
Tushushu
27f2095bcd
Implement Instance Normalization ( #1321 )
...
* config
* rename as instances, otherwise won't work
* refactor
* InstanceNormConfig
* remove unused var
* forward
* rename
* based on gn
* unit tests
* fix tests
* update doc
* update onnx doc
* renaming method
* add comment
---------
Co-authored-by: VungleTienan <tienan.liu@vungle.com>
2024-02-23 23:31:43 -06:00
Dilshod Tadjibaev
08302e38fc
Fix broken test and run-checks script ( #1347 )
2024-02-23 10:06:51 -05:00
Aasheesh Singh
c86db83fa9
Add support for Any, All operations to Tensor ( #1342 )
...
* add any, all op implementation for all tensor types
* add op to burn-book
* fix formatting
* refactor tensor operations from numeric to BaseOps.
* fix book doc
* comments fix and add more tests
2024-02-23 10:06:31 -05:00
Dilshod Tadjibaev
d6e859330f
Pytorch message updates ( #1344 )
...
* Update pytorch-model.md
* Update error.rs
2024-02-22 12:12:50 -06:00
Guillaume Lagrange
bff4961426
Add enum module support ( #1337 )
2024-02-21 17:03:34 -05:00
Sylvain Benner
4427768570
[refactor] Move burn crates to their own crates directory ( #1336 )
2024-02-20 13:57:55 -05:00